2019 Men's Lacrosse

19 Nick Willertz

  • Height 6-3
  • Weight 190
  • Year Senior
  • Hometown Severn, MD
  • High School Mount St. Joseph
  • Position M
  • Major Computer Science

Biography

2019 Third-Team All-ODAC
2018 IMLCA First-Team All-Region
2018 Second-Team All-State
2018 First-Team All-ODAC
2017 Second-Team All-ODAC

2019 (Senior): Made 20 appearances on the season with three starts ... Scored 18 goals and made eight assists after transitioning from defensive midfielder to offense ... Also scooped 11 ground balls and caused seven turnovers ... Enjoyed his first-career multi-goal game March 10 vs. Elizabethtown, adding an assist, a caused turnover and a ground ball ... Tallied two goals, two assists and two caused turnovers in a win over Roanoke April 5.

2018 (Junior): Played in all 21 games with 19 starts as a staple in the midfield ... Totaled four goals and four assists to go with 44 ground balls and 15 caused turnovers ... Picked up five ground balls and caused three turnovers March 16 vs. No. 1 RIT ... Had a goal, an assist, and four ground balls March 31 at Roanoke ... Made an assist and picked up four ground balls May 5 in the ODAC championship vs. No. 17 Roanoke ... Tallied five ground balls and three caused turnovers in the NCAA tournament at No. 9 Dickinson.

2017 (Sophomore): Once again was a key component to the Hornet midfield, playing in all 22 games in his second year...totaled three goals with six assists, while leading the team with 63 ground ball controls...also caused 11 turnovers...netted a goal while picking up five ground balls against ODAC-rival Shenandoah on April 5th.

2016 (Freshman): Made a major impact as a freshman, playing in 20 games for the Hornets...had three goals and an assist, but made major contributions on the defensive side of the field, picking up 32 groundballs and causing 10 turnovers...netted his first career goal against Bridgewater on 3/12...had a huge day on 4/9 against then #20 Roanoke, scoring two goals on two shots in a one-goal win...was named the LC co-Male Rookie of the Year. 

Before Lynchburg: One-year starter, Captain, played in Maryland Senior All-Star game, Brine Maryland team.
